Infleqtion is on a mission to commercialize atom-based quantum technologies that deliver orders-of-magnitude improvements in sensing and computing applications. We are seeking self-motivated, energetic individuals with exceptional problem-solving and technical skills to help drive our Quantum Computing mission forward.

Requirements

  • Experience with Python and at least one compiled language, with a desire to work in Rust
  • Experience with Linux and virtualization technologies like Docker
  • Skilled in typical software engineering disciplines: testing, debugging, revision control, error-handling, readability, documentation, general code health, etc.
  • Desire to constantly improve and learn inside and outside of expertise
  • Domain-specific experience in statistics, machine learning, or AMO physics
  • Experience with Numpy, Scipy, and Pytorch
  • Experience with image analysis, emphasis on realtime object detection

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and deploy reliable, maintainable, scalable, and fault-tolerant backend services and frameworks that control and calibrate our neutral atom quantum computers.
  • Coll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, including scientists, opto-mechanical engineers, and electrical engineers, to solve complex problems and deliver high-quality software solutions.
  • Empower interdisciplinary teams to create the tools they need by teaching engineering and programming best practices.
  • Mentor and guide junior engineers, fostering their growth and enhancing the team's technical expertise.
  • Lead code and design reviews, upholding engineering best practices and promoting a culture of quality and collaboration.
  • Support and debug all layers of the control stack from real-time embedded kernels to distributed services.
  • Advocate for and implement innovative software development methodologies and tools to improve team efficiency and product quality.
